titleOfInvention Image forming device
abstract (57) Abstract: To eliminate the occurrence of image deletion, improve toner transfer efficiency and cleaning performance, and obtain a high density image in a liquid developing type image forming apparatus. Further, the occurrence of cracks in the surface protective layer at the end of the photoconductor is eliminated. A photoconductor (1) comprising an organic photosensitive layer (3) and a surface protection layer (4) made of amorphous silicon carbide on a substrate (2), wherein the surface protection layer (4) contains fluorine to reduce surface free energy. The film stress is set to 10 to 40 mN / m and the film stress is set to 9 × 10 7 N / m 2 or less. Then, an image forming apparatus for liquid development equipped with the photoconductor is provided.
